QuickIO 项目教程
quickio A Java embedded database. 项目地址: https://gitcode.com/gh_mirrors/qu/quickio
1. 项目的目录结构及介绍
QuickIO 是一个 Java 嵌入式数据库项目,其目录结构如下:
quickio/
├── gradle/
│ └── wrapper/
├── src/
│ ├── main/
│ │ ├── java/
│ │ └── resources/
│ └── test/
│ ├── java/
│ └── resources/
├── .gitignore
├── LICENSE
├── README.md
├── build.gradle
├── gradlew
├── gradlew.bat
└── settings.gradle
目录结构介绍
- gradle/wrapper/: 包含 Gradle Wrapper 的相关文件,用于确保项目使用一致的 Gradle 版本进行构建。
- src/main/java/: 包含项目的 Java 源代码。
- src/main/resources/: 包含项目的资源文件,如配置文件等。
- src/test/java/: 包含项目的测试代码。
- src/test/resources/: 包含测试所需的资源文件。
- .gitignore: Git 忽略文件,指定哪些文件或目录不需要被版本控制。
- LICENSE: 项目的开源许可证文件。
- README.md: 项目的介绍文档。
- build.gradle: Gradle 构建脚本,定义项目的依赖和构建任务。
- gradlew: Gradle Wrapper 的 Unix 脚本。
- gradlew.bat: Gradle Wrapper 的 Windows 批处理脚本。
- settings.gradle: Gradle 设置文件,定义项目的模块和仓库。
2. 项目的启动文件介绍
QuickIO 项目的启动文件通常是 build.gradle
文件。该文件定义了项目的依赖、插件、任务等。以下是 build.gradle
文件的部分内容示例:
plugins {
id 'java'
}
repositories {
mavenCentral()
}
dependencies {
implementation 'com.github.artbits:quickio:1.4.1'
}
sourceCompatibility = '1.8'
targetCompatibility = '1.8'
启动文件介绍
- plugins: 定义了项目使用的 Gradle 插件,如
java
插件。 - repositories: 定义了项目的依赖仓库,通常使用
mavenCentral()
。 - dependencies: 定义了项目的依赖库,如 QuickIO 的依赖。
- sourceCompatibility 和 targetCompatibility: 定义了 Java 编译的版本。
3. 项目的配置文件介绍
QuickIO 项目的配置文件通常位于 src/main/resources/
目录下。虽然 QuickIO 本身没有特定的配置文件,但你可以根据需要添加自定义的配置文件。
配置文件示例
假设你需要添加一个 application.properties
文件来配置数据库路径:
# application.properties
db.path=./example_db
配置文件介绍
- application.properties: 自定义的配置文件,用于存储数据库路径等配置信息。
通过以上步骤,你可以了解 QuickIO 项目的目录结构、启动文件和配置文件的基本情况。根据项目的实际需求,你可以进一步扩展和定制这些内容。
quickio A Java embedded database. 项目地址: https://gitcode.com/gh_mirrors/qu/quickio
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考